Across TCGA patient cohorts, OR51B6 mutation is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 1,332 significant associations in total. UCEC sh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ible OR51B6-associated genes across cancer lineages are RNU6-1213P, RNA5SP461, and ESS2. Each is linked with OR51B6 in more than 2 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both OR51B6-to-partner and partner-to-OR51B6 results are reported.
